Winemaker's Notes:
The first Hatzidakis wine contains Aidani with a little bit of Assyrtiko from non-irrigated, ungrafted, organic old vines. Fermented and matured in stainless steel this fantastic white wine has pale yellow color with a delicate nose citrus, roses and apricots, and just a hint of smoke with a medium body and that warm fleshy apricot fruit. It is a dry wine (one can sense the acidic Assyrtiko) but the aromatic Aidani seems to provide a mellow mouthfeel. Brilliant, clean and delicious wine that works well with Greek foods and Asian foods.Ben 6/10
